Axiom vs Clicky: editorial side-by-side

A
Axiom
ANALYTICS
6.3

Axiom is rebuilding observability so an AI agent, not a human, can be the first user.

◆ Current state

Axiom is a logs, traces and metrics platform that reached feature parity on the fundamentals earlier this year — metrics went generally available in March, dashboards got a full API, and Correlations tied the three data types together for investigations. The last two months have been spent thickening the console: collapsible dashboard sections, gauge elements, schema locking, Grafana as a query surface. Underneath that steady product work, a second track has been running the whole time, aimed at AI agents as operators rather than at humans.

◆ Where it's heading

That second track is now the main story. Metrics shipped queryable by agents through MCP and a dedicated skill, monitor management moved into the agent surface alongside the Grafana work, and evaluations arrived as both a live-traffic scoring feature and an agent-authored skill. The August release takes it to the account layer: an agent can now create its own Axiom organization and have a human claim it afterwards. Axiom is systematically removing the assumption that a person is present at each step.

◆ Prediction

The remaining human-gated surfaces are billing, access control, and dataset provisioning, and agent-created orgs makes those the obvious next targets. Expect the skills catalogue to keep growing into a set of task-shaped agent entry points rather than a single MCP endpoint.

C
Clicky
ANALYTICS
2.5

Clicky ships meaningful bot-blocking improvements but ships infrequently—four entries over five months with no new analytical features.

◆ Current state

Clicky is a real-time web analytics platform that has been running since 2007. The product ships infrequently; the four most recent entries span April through August 2026. The most substantive release adds User Agent-based bot filtering with new country-level controls. A threat intelligence false positive incident (July 2026) required user intervention to correct misclassification by external security vendors.

◆ Where it's heading

Clicky is maintaining its existing feature set—bot blocking, affiliate programs, backlinks—without adding new analytical capabilities. The product appears in steady-state maintenance mode rather than active feature development. The backlinks spotlight post (April 2026) suggests the team is aware some features go unused, and is investing in documentation/education rather than new development.

◆ Prediction

Clicky is unlikely to ship directional new features in the near term based on this cadence. The more likely moves are continued bot-blocking improvements and program-level incentives (affiliate credits) to retain its existing user base.
